Fair Trade & Earth Friendly Accessories
By creating accessories with cotton or jute rather than synthetic materials such as polyester, we invite you to become a responsible shopper as you rediscover the comfort of natural fibers. Our fair trade jackets, hair bands, scarves and wallets from Nepal are also made from natural fibers such as recycled cotton, recycled silk and hemp.

Ethically-Sourced Artisan Jewelry
Our new line of Gambian locally-sourced silver is a line created by Samba Bach. Investing in finished products, rather than simply raw materials, we are committed to the highest form of economic empowerment for union silver workers and silversmiths in this West African nation. Fair Trade ensures that artisans are paid a fair, living wage, often 10 times or more above their country's minimum wage.

Reduced, Reused & Recycled Handmade Crafts
We reduce woodcarver's dependence on forest-cut wood by supporting smaller carvings, often which are made from scrap wood or reclaimed wood from older carvings or benches. Also, our carvers and women's groups in Africa are now turning to alternative media for their art - recycled trash! Cans, flip-flops, sawdust, magazines, plastic bags, and bottle caps are among some of the components they recycle creatively to make unique, fair trade and green gifts for you to enjoy!

Exquisite Onyx Stone Carvings from Pakistan
From the mountains of the Afghanistan/Pakistan border, huge calcite blocks of onyx stone are transformed into candleholders, nativity sets, pears, and animals by carvers of Dominion Traders. Our complete line can be seen and purchased (retail or wholesale) in the online store.
